Eger's Long-fingered Bat Miniopterus egeri
A bat found in Madagascar, described as a new species in 2011.

Yanbaru Whiskered Bat Myotis yanbarensis
It is known only from three islands of the Ryukyu Archipelago, south of Japan, Okinawa (where the Yanbaru forest is situated), Amami Ōshima, and Tokunoshima. The species has been classified as Critically Endangered by the IUCN.

Small Mauritian flying fox
Engraving from 1763
The Small Mauritian Flying Fox, Pteropus subniger, went extinct in the 1860's (according to the IUCN Redlist). Its relative the Mauritian Flying Fox, Pteropus niger, is currently endangered and faces attacks from humans (see this National Geographic Article).
